- The distance between Mount Airy, Nc, Usa and Lytton, Bc, Canada is approximately 3,528 km or 2,192 mi.
- To reach Mount Airy, Nc in this distance one would set out from Lytton, Bc bearing 98.9°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Mount Airy, Nc bearing 127.7° or SE .
- Mount Airy, Nc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Lytton, Bc has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- Mount Airy, Nc is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Lytton, Bc is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 4.1 °C (7.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.7 °C (3.1°F) less in Mount Airy, Nc.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 735.9 mm (29 in) more which is equivalent to 735.9 l/m² (18.06 US gal/ft²) or 7,359,000 l/ha (786,726 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.2° higher in Mount Airy, Nc than in Lytton, Bc.
